My rich friends SHAMED me for refusing to pay £120 on a birthday dinner with them – am I the bad guy?
A SINGLE mother has shared how her friends shamed her for refusing to split a hefty bill at the restaurant when she ordered less than everybody.
The cash-strapped woman revealed that her rich acquaintances expected her to pay for the dinner they invited her to.
Aryan Strauss posted a cautionary tale, advising her followers to never eat in a group without discussing the budget beforehand.
In a viral TikTok post, the woman explained that her successful model friend invited her to a birthday dinner where she didn't know anybody else.
Some attendees appeared to be well-off - with one woman showing off her expensive new breast implants.
Despite her precarious financial situation, the savvy mum prepared enough cash for herself and the birthday girl and purchased a buy-one-get-one-free coupon for the Brazilian-style steakhouse.

She and her friend then ordered a £20 main each - but Strauss subsequently complained about her meal and had it taken off the bill.
She said: "I ordered a piece of fillet Mignon that was so fatty, it was gross.
"My friend called over the manager while I was rinsing my mouth off in the bathroom."
"I order water and I order no dessert," the TikToker continued, estimating that the waiter would charge her only £20 for her friend's portion of the dinner.
Strauss noted that some of the other guests departed the dinner early, but she figured they would have worked out the payment arrangements with the birthday girl.
But when the final bill arrived, the struggling mother was shocked to see that the group demanded that she pay a whooping £120 to cover others who had dined and dashed.
She refused to concede to the ridiculous demand and agreed to pay £40 despite ordering just £20 worth of food.
She embarrassingly only had eight pounds in cash, which she intended to leave as a tip, and £38 in her account.
"I have no money, I'm a single mum," she said in a video.
Strauss claims she was compelled to write a cheque to her buddy, who was "definitely irritated" about the situation, because she didn't have £40 in her bank to cover her part.
"Never sit down to dinner with anybody, friend or otherwise, unless you’ve already talked about how it’s getting split, and what your budget is if you’re all going to split the bill evenly," she warned her followers.
After being made to feel like the bag guy in the situation, the single mother complained that her friend had done this to her in the past whilst knowing of her financial situation.
Hundreds of viewers sided with the TikToker, saying they would also refuse to pay for someone else.
"Anybody who gets mad because one person paid for their own meal just wanted a discount," one user wrote.
Another one added: "I'm not cheap but it really bugs me when people order extra extra extra bottles of wine, dessert and then they want to split the bill."
"I feel if you're the one inviting you're the one paying," commented one person.
Another one chimed in, saying: "In group settings, I always make it very clear that if I'm not sleeping with you or if I didn't change your diapers I will not be covering your bill."
But some people criticised the single mother for going out without money.
"If you don't have money, don't go. Don't put yourself in bad situations, " one person wrote.
Another commented: "If you can't afford it, don't do it. That was one thing my mother taught me don't go anywhere without any money."
